Israeli Airstrike in Gaza: Children Injured in Al-Zeitoun Neighborhood
In a tragic development, an Israeli airstrike targeted the Al-Zeitoun neighborhood located southeast of Gaza City, resulting in injuries to several children. This incident, reported on July 5, 2025, has raised alarms regarding the ongoing conflict and its devastating impact on civilian lives, particularly among the youth. As the situation continues to evolve, the international community is urged to pay closer attention to the humanitarian crises arising from military actions in the region.
The airstrike, which occurred in a densely populated area, underscores the perils faced by civilians in conflict zones. Reports indicate that children were among those injured, prompting widespread condemnation and calls for accountability. The images shared on social media highlight the dire consequences of such military operations, emphasizing the urgent need for protective measures for vulnerable populations, especially children who bear the brunt of violence.
